WebStack Implementation in Python. A stack is a linear data structure that follows the LIFO (Last–In, First–Out) order, i.e., items can be inserted or removed only at one end of it. The stack supports the following standard operations: push: Pushes an item at the top of the stack. pop: Remove and return the item from the top of the stack. WebFirst, you add a new function.
